## Step 4: Sign your DiffLens plugin bundle

Before publishing a plugin for DiffLens, the large-file diff viewer built by Quartzbay Tools, you must sign the packaged bundle. Unsigned plugins are rejected by the marketplace validator, and partially signed bundles fail silently during chunked rendering, so double-check the manifest hash before signing. Run the packager with the --sign flag against your local keystore, then verify the output with difflens-verify. The signature must be generated with the deploy key shown below.

release key, yafog-kadug: bky13_ADqM5YQWZutLX

Finance Review Summary — Capacity Decision

Heads of department: the Tarrowfield plant runs at 93% utilisation; Greymoor at 61%. Expanding Tarrowfield costs less per unit than rebalancing lines to Greymoor, but lead times differ sharply. Capex envelope holds at prior guidance. Decision due end of month; inputs to Halvor Brint by Friday. The confidential expansion plan is set out below.

internal memo for hafog-hadug: The pricing group signed off on a budget of $16.1 million for Project Gorir. The renewal with Oliionax Systems closes at $14.1 million a year, 46 percent above the last contract.

## Account Recovery — Trailnote Offline Mode

When a surveyor's Trailnote app has been offline for 30+ days, their local credentials expire and sync refuses to resume. Don't make them wipe the device — all their unsynced field data lives there! Instead, open the support console, pick "Offline Reinstate," and enter their handle. The console will ask for the support team's shared recovery passphrase before issuing a reinstatement token. Use the one below.

unlock words, bagaf-fajeg: zorael-kelax-fraath-quenix-eliok-sileth-aldmir-wenir-druiel

Release 4.2 of Ledgerline changes how report exports handle timezones. All scheduled exports now render timestamps in the workspace's configured timezone instead of UTC. If a customer reports shifted dates, confirm their workspace setting before escalating; most cases trace back to a legacy default of UTC left over from migration. The export service must be redeployed with the updated bundle, which is signed per standard policy. Verify the bundle against the signing key below.

rollout seal: bky9_PeXH1fTLY